Miami International Holdings, Inc.

FINANCIAL SERVICES · CAPITAL MARKETS · USA

Miami International Holdings, Inc. is a prominent player in the global financial services sector, primarily recognized for its operations through the Miami International Exchange (MIAX). With a commitment to leveraging cutting-edge technology, MIAX enhances market efficiency for a diverse range of institutional investors and traders, establishing itself as a key venue in the options and derivatives trading landscape. The company's strategic focus on innovative solutions, rigorous risk management, and adherence to regulatory standards positions it as a reliable marketplace that attracts liquidity providers in a rapidly evolving financial environment.

Morgan Stanley

FINANCIAL SERVICES · CAPITAL MARKETS · USA

Morgan Stanley is an American multinational investment bank and financial services company headquartered at 1585 Broadway in the Morgan Stanley Building, Midtown Manhattan, New York City.
